Rajan calls on Jaitley ahead of monetary policy
Source: PTI
May 25, 2016 17:27 IST

Reserve Bank of India Governor Raghuram Rajan on Wednesday called on Finance Minister Arun Jaitley and is believed to have discussed macro-economic situation ahead of the second bi-monthly monetary policy next month.

"I have no comments. . .," replied Rajan on questions regarding the meeting.

The Governor, however, added that he would be holding a press conference in about two-weeks, in apparent reference to his post-monetary policy interaction with media.

The second bi-monthly monetary policy announcement is scheduled on June 7 amid clamour for further rate cut with a view to boosting the economic growth.

The Reserve Bank has reduced interest rate by 150 basis points since January 2015 to give a fillip to the economic growth.
